Client Profile
An organization hosted a public-facing business application on a production server.
The same server also hosted a separate internal application that was not exposed to the internet. The internal application however contained a known vulnerability.
Business Challenge
The company detected suspicious activity on the server but could not determine the full scope of the compromise.
The key questions were:
How did the attacker get in? What did they access? How far did they get? And why wasn't the activity detected earlier?
Our Approach
Our digital forensics team performed a forensic examination of the affected server, analysing system, application, authentication, and network artefacts to reconstruct the attack timeline.
We established:
- The attacker's initial point of access through the public-facing application
- How the attacker interacted with the vulnerable internal application
- The activity that followed the exploitation
- Accounts, processes, files, and systems accessed during the compromise
- Evidence of attempts to move further into the environment
We then used the forensic findings to identify gaps in the client's existing security monitoring and detection capabilities.
This included determining which stages of the attack generated telemetry but were not being monitored, where relevant activity could have been detected earlier, and which security controls failed to provide sufficient visibility.
Finally, we provided targeted recommendations to address the findings — including improvements to logging, detection coverage, monitoring, segmentation, and security controls around the affected applications and server.
Outcome
The engagement gave the client more than a timeline of what happened.
It showed how the attacker entered, what they did, what the client could and could not see, and what needed to change to reduce the likelihood of a similar compromise going undetected.
